This product is a sterile, pre-set vacuum blood collection tube engineered in strict accordance with clinical laboratory standards, containing high-quality EDTA-K2 (Dipotassium Ethylenediaminetetraacetate) anticoagulant. Its precise 2mL draw volume is optimized for routine hematological tests, such as Complete Blood Count (CBC), blood typing, and other related analyses. The universally recognized purple cap allows for quick and easy identification by healthcare professionals, effectively minimizing the risk of procedural errors in busy clinical settings.

EDTA tube is a type of blood collection tube that contains 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id (EDTA) as an anticoagulant. EDTA works by binding to calcium ions in the blood, which prevents clotting and helps preserve the sample for laboratory analysis.
The primary purpose of using EDTA tubes is to collect blood samples for various laboratory tests, particularly those related to blood cell counts and blood typing. EDTA helps maintain the integrity of the blood sample by preventing coagulation and ensuring reliable test results.
EDTA works by chelating calcium ions in the blood, which are essential for the coagulation process. By binding these ions, EDTA prevents clot formation.

K2 EDTA tubes contain dipotassium EDTA, while K3 EDTA tubes contain tripotassium EDTA, differing in concentration and specific applications.
Both types effectively prevent clotting, but the choice between them may depend on specific laboratory protocols and test requirements.
